Possibly getting on your Dad's insurance if it is the same policy would help but, he cannot legally cover you unless you are in college. Sometimes an employer's insurance may cover part of it but it really depends on the company you are working for. I have seen some of my guy's get covered on a preexisiting case but it is a Fortune 500 company. Our side business insurer would not cover something like that. It all matters around volume of customers on an account and the company agreement. It may be a long shot but you can try and go to work for WalMart.
